Expression of CD163 on human histiocytic cells is different in tuberculosis-induced and schistosomiasis-induced granulomas

Sir. Granulomatous inflammation can be characterized by the predominant type of participating T-cell help, either type 1 T-cell help (Th1) or Th2 predominance. In Th1-mediated granulomas, cytokines with potent pro-inflammatory activity, such as interferon (IFN)-gamma, interleukin (IL)-12, and tumour necrosis factor-alpha, are abundant. In Th2-mediated granulomas, the predominant cytokines, IL-4, IL-5, IL-10, and IL-13, have variable levels of immune-modulating activity. Established mouse models exist for both Thl-mediated and Th2-mediated granulomas. Thl-mediated granulomas in the lungs are induced by pulmonary embolization with Mycobacterium tuberculosis antigen-coated pellets, and Th2-mediated granulomas by pulmonary embolization with Schistosoma mansoni antigen-coated pellets. CD163, a member of the scavenger receptor cysteine-rich family, is expressed only on cells of the monocytic lineage. Recently, CD163 has been suggested to be a pattern recognition receptor and a critical part of innate immunity. Expression of CD163 can be up-regulated by anti-inflammatory stimuli such as glucocorticoids and IL-10, and upon stimulation of Toll-like receptors. Proinflammatory IFN-gamma of Thl T cells leads to down-regulation of CD163 expression.6 There is also evidence for down-regulation by Th2 IL-4 and IL-13.5 In Thl-mediated granulomas, as IFN-y and IL-12 are the predominant cytokines, low levels of CD163 expression would be expected. In Th2-mediated granulomas, which are characterized by cytokines such as IL-4 and IL-10, expression depends on whether the inhibitory effects of IL-4 or the activating effects of IL-10 are predominant. We would expect CD163 expression to be more pronounced than in Thl-mediated granulomas. In foreign body (FB) reactions, which are classically seen to be independent of T-cell help, the level of CD163 expression is not predictable. In the present study, we characterized patterns of CD163 expression by the monocytic lineage in archetypical Th1-induced, Th2-induced and non-immunological FB-induced granulomas.
